AI Contract Overview
The contract involves the installation of ADA-compliant signage across municipal buildings in Springfield and Wilbraham, Massachusetts, with a focus on ensuring full accessibility for individuals with visual impairments. All signage must include tactile characters, braille, proper vertical and horizontal mounting heights, and high-contrast color schemes to meet federal accessibility standards. The work is classified under NAICS code 238390, indicating it falls under other specialty trade contracting, specifically related to sign installation and modification. The project is structured as a subcontract and is open for bids with a response deadline set for August 19, 2026, at 7:00 PM. All installations must be completed at the designated municipal facilities in the 01095 zip code area. The contracting entity is the 36 - WIL/Selectmen's Office under the Massachusetts state administration, though no point of contact or detailed procurement method is provided in the data.
